New Year's in Chicago? |
Travel Info My boyfriend and I will be spending new year's in Chicago. I was googling and found "Nacional 27." It's a latin restaurant/salsa dancing place. Has anyone ever been here and can you tell me about it? We were thinking of spending New Year's Eve here. Also, please give me ideas of other places that may have some fun things to do on this night. We're from DC and it will be our 1st time Chicago and we are SUPER excited! Travel Tips Nactional 27 is a great restaurant/bar. You'll have a goodtime. Don't know about that ball drop thing that other guy was talking about. We don't do that here. But if you go to Navy Pier, they have fireworks. They also have a big party in the ballroom at the end of the pier (it's where the TV stations go for the big countdown). You can find Navy Pier on the web; they may have info about the party and available tickets. There's also the Signature Room at the top of the John Hancock building. Not sure if they have somethng special going on (usually you can just go to the bar and drink). But it overlooks the whole city and you can see the fireworks at Navy Pier from above. Finally, check the Metromix and Time Out Chicago websites. They'll have all the listings of clubs, bars, etc. and what they're doing for New Year's Eve.
